The phrase "alignment to maximize"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used in contexts where you are discussing strategies or methods aimed at optimizing outcomes or efficiency.
Example: "Our goal is to achieve alignment to maximize the effectiveness of our team efforts."
Alternatives: "coordination to enhance" or "synchronization to optimize".
